Hi all

I have recently redone the bathroom including a brand new bath, upon delivery and opening there was a very, very strong GRP/resin smell and i thought it might dissapate once all fitted etc, however 3 weeks down the line the smell is still present and when i am actually in the bath it is so overpowering in terms of the almost solvent type smell i have to get out as it gives me a headache!

any ideas or experience of anything similar before i phone the company up?

I'd leave your bathroom extractor running for a week or so to help draw the smell away. You have got one, haven't you?
 
not yet, getting my mate to fit one because we have been using the one that came with the house.........the window lol but of course its bloody freezing now so will be fitting a vent/fan.

is it normal that it should smell so strong?

I don't know, I can't smell yours. But hot new plastic is liable to smell. An extractor fan will remove smells and also the condensation that causes mould and mildew in bathrooms that have their windows closed.

The sooner you get your extractor running, the better
